The industrious hackers at the Hackint0sh forums have reached a milestone in iPhone cracking. Using the iPhoneInterface application, forum members have successfully enabled a shell on the iPhone. A shell essentially gives access to the underlying Unix layer of the iPhone, and according to member 'ghex':
To do this yourself, you'll need to make an iPhone to serial cable, but if you are a confident solderer it will be easy, requiring few components (detailed in the forum thread). This after only a week. It can't be long before somebody installs Linux on this thing.
